Frequently Asked Questions
π πΊοΈ Getting There
Fletcher Place is easily accessible by car, with 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ft being popular options. The Indianapolis Cultural Trail also provides a scenic and safe way to walk or bike into the neighborhood from surrounding areas, including downtown and Lucas Oil Stadium.
Yes, Fletcher Place is a very walkable neighborhood. Many residents and visitors enjoy strolling through its streets to explore local businesses and attractions.
Yes, walking from Lucas Oil Stadium to Fletcher Place at night, even around midnight on a weekend, is generally considered safe, especially if you utilize the Cultural Trail.
Exploring Fletcher Place on foot is highly recommended to soak in the atmosphere. For longer distances or connecting to other parts of the city, the Indianapolis Cultural Trail is an excellent option for walking or biking.
While specific bus routes may vary, Fletcher Place is generally well-connected to the broader Indianapolis public transportation network. Checking local transit schedules is advised for the most up-to-date information.

π½οΈ π½οΈ Food & Dining
Fletcher Place is renowned for its culinary scene. Amelia's Bakery is a must-visit for pastries and bread. Other popular spots include Bluebeard and The Dugout, offering diverse dining experiences.
Amelia's Bakery is frequently cited as having the best croissants in Indianapolis, located in Fletcher Place. It's highly recommended to get there early as they are known to sell out.
Absolutely! Fletcher Place is within walking distance of many excellent dining establishments, including popular spots like Bluebeard and The Dugout, making it a great area for food lovers.
Fletcher Place offers a variety of culinary delights, from artisanal baked goods at Amelia's to diverse menus at local restaurants. You can find everything from casual pub fare to more refined dining experiences.
Popular spots, especially Amelia's Bakery, can get very busy and sell out quickly. For sit-down restaurants, making reservations, particularly on weekends, is often a good idea to avoid long waits.
